Observation details
Continuing bird. The CONW as it made a brief appearance at approx 8:45am it was spotted through an opening of the jewelweed that surrounded the area as it walked down lower (not hopped) disappearing easily into the weeds. While other observers on the scene were able to see the hood and complete white eyeing, (I was a little late to see it) my glimpse of it was the rest of the body and tail as foliage covered my view of it's face as it walked down lower. It was entirely yellow below and up to almost the tip of it's tail which was shorter than a COYE. The upper body was an oliveish color. The only photo I was able to get (which is blurry) is attached for record purposes.
